PECAN-PEACH COBBLER RECIPE - PILLSBURY.COM



Pecan-Peach Cobbler Recipe - Pillsbury.com image

This mouthwatering cobbler with pecans and peaches is easy thanks to refrigerated Pillsbury™ Pie Crusts. Make ahead and freeze!

Provided by Pillsbury Kitchens

Total Time 1 hours 40 minutes

Prep Time 45 minutes

Yield 10

Number Of Ingredients 8

12 peaches, peeled, sliced (16 cups)
3 1/4 cups sugar
1/3 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
2/3 cup butter
1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la
2 boxes (14.1 oz) refrigerated Pillsbury™ Pie Crusts (2 Count), softened as directed on box
1/2 cup chopped pecans, toasted

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 475°F. In Dutch oven, stir peaches, 3 cups of sugar, flour and nutmeg. Let stand 10 minutes. Heat to boiling; reduce heat. Simmer 10 minutes or until peaches are tender. Remove from heat; stir in butter and vanilla.
  • Remove 2 pie crusts from pouches; unroll on work surface. Sprinkle 1/4 cup of the pecans and 2 tablespoons sugar over 1 crust; top with second crust. Roll into 12-inch round, gently pressing pecans into dough. Cut into 1 1/2-inch strips. Repeat with remaining 2 pie crusts, 1/4 cup pecans and 2 tablespoons sugar.
  • Spoon half of peach mixture into greased 13x9-inch or 2 8-inch baking dishes. Arrange half of pastry strips in lattice design over mixture. Bake 20 minutes or until lightly browned. Spoon remaining peach mixture over baked pastry. Top with remaining pastry strips in lattice design. Bake 15 minutes longer or until filling is bubbly and pastry is lightly browned. Serve warm or cold.

LATTICE-TOPPED FRENCH ONION AND CHICKEN RICE BAKE RECIPE ...



Lattice-Topped French Onion and Chicken Rice Bake Recipe ... image

Chicken, rice, caramelized onions and Swiss cheese come together for a comforting dinner that promises to take the bite out of any chilly night. Plus, who can resist that flaky lattice crust top?

Provided by Pillsbury Kitchens

Total Time 1 hours 10 minutes

Prep Time 40 minutes

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 10

1/2 cup butter
4 cups halved and thickly sliced sweet onions (about 2 large onions)
1 1/2 cups uncooked instant white rice
2 cups Progresso™ beef flavored broth (from 32-oz carton)
1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
2 cups shredded deli rotisserie chicken
1 cup shredded Swiss cheese (4 oz)
1 can (8 oz) refrigerated Pillsbury™ Original Crescent Dough Sheet
1 tablespoon butter, melted
1/2 teaspoon dried thyme leaves

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 375°F. Spray 13x9-inch (3-quart) glass baking dish with cooking spray.
  • In 12-inch skillet, melt 1/2 cup butter over medium-high heat until sizzling. Cook onions in butter 15 to 20 minutes, stirring frequently, until onions are very soft and golden brown.
  • Stir in rice; cook 2 to 3 minutes, stirring frequently, until toasted. Stir in broth and Worcestershire sauce. Heat to simmering, stirring occasionally. Stir in chicken; cook 3 to 4 minutes or until heated. Stir in cheese, mixing to combine. Transfer hot mixture to baking dish; cover and keep warm.
  • Unroll dough on work surface; cut lengthwise into 8 strips. Arrange 4 strips lengthwise on top of filling. Cut remaining 4 in half, and lay crosswise on top of other strips to form a lattice design over chicken mixture. Brush dough with 1 tablespoon melted butter; sprinkle thyme on top.
  • Bake 18 to 22 minutes or until filling is bubbly and crust is deep golden brown. Let stand 5 minutes before serving.
